Conduction cooling using ultra-pure fine metal wire I: pure aluminium.

Summary
In this paper, the heat-transfer performance of 6N pure aluminium is reported, followed by a brief review of conduction theory on pure metals. It was confirmed that thermal conductivity of 6N pure aluminium fine wires reached 40,000 W/(m.K) at 6 K. The study also describes vibration transfer through a heat link made of pure aluminium.
